THE BROOK HILL SCHOOL INC, founded in 1993, is a mid-sized nonprofit in the Education sector that reported $16.7M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ue fell 29%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Net assets of $49.9M represent 36 months of operating reserves.

Mission

CHRISTIAN SCHOOL TO PROVIDE EXCELLENCE IN COLLEGE PREPARATORY EDUCATION, AFFIRM THE GIFTS AND CHALLENGE THE POTENTIAL OF EACH STUDENT AND ENCOURAGE STUDENTS TO HONOR GOD THROUGH CHRIST-LIKE CHARACTOER
